Transaction 877aa7bb3c9d1c22d8d22ad0852161530eadab3eb6a2fe8c67c256a6db9d0ef4
1 Input
1 Outputs
- 877aa7bb3c9d1c22d8d22ad0852161530eadab3eb6a2fe8c67c256a6db9d0ef4:0
value 100999372
address mprG4iPQL5xEhjmzD6S3ngYyYMuZUug7ab